Mama says that even though this Bulldog puppy is adorable, please do not apply human cosmetics on a dog. Make-up has a ton of chemicals which can irritate a dog’s skin, but it can also harm their health. The chemicals in cosmetics can be very poisonous and deadly to your dog.
